How to Choose the Right Optics for Your Application:
What makes an optic the right choice for your laser system? This lecture provides a practical introduction to key optical parameters and how they influence performance. Learn how refractive and reflective components, especially aspheres and freeforms, improve system integration and affect beam quality. Topics include surface quality, coatings, and the role of aberrations, with real-world examples and application-oriented insights.
Laser Beam Shaping:
Discover how tailored beam shaping can unlock the full potential of your laser. This lecture explores methods to manipulate intensity distributions and focal shapes using aspheres, axicons, DOEs, and more. Gain insights into smart component selection and strategies to reduce speckle, improve uniformity, and enhance application-specific performance.
About the Speaker
After joining asphericon in 2010 as an optical designer, Dr. Fuchs focused early on linking manufacturing and metrology of aspherics and freeform optics with questcaions in optical design. As Vice President Strategy & Innovation, she now coordinates all R&D activities at asphericon as well as strategic product development.
She has already been able to register 6 patent families and is the inaugural winner of the Optica Kevin P. Thompson Optical Design Innovator Award. Furthermore, she has been working as an Associated Editor for Optics Express from 2018 to 2024 and is the author of more than 60 publications. She holds a doctorate in physics from the Friedrich Schiller University of Jena. In 2020, she was elected Fellow of OPTICA and serves as Director at Large on the Board of Directors of Optica from 2023 to 2025.
